The Bachelor’s in Electrical (Electronic) Engineering at Northern Kentucky University is an undergraduate programme that teaches the theory and practical skills needed to design, analyse and test electronic and electrical systems. It suits students who enjoy mathematics, physics and hands‑on laboratory work and who want careers in electronics, embedded systems, power, telecommunications or related engineering fields.

What you'll study

The curriculum combines core engineering science and mathematics with focused study in electronic systems. You will study circuit analysis, analogue and digital electronics, signals and systems, microprocessors and embedded systems, control systems, power electronics, and communications. Coursework emphasises both theory and laboratory practice, with guided lab work in analogue/digital circuit construction, PCB design, microcontroller programming, and measurement and instrumentation.

Typical components include:

  • Foundations in calculus, differential equations and linear algebra
  • Core electrical and electronic courses: circuit theory, electronics, signals and systems
  • Specialist topics: microcontrollers and embedded systems, digital systems design, power systems and power electronics, control theory, and communications
  • Laboratory and project courses providing hands‑on experience with oscilloscopes, function generators, PCB prototyping, FPGA development boards and software tools for simulation and design
  • Design sequence culminating in a senior capstone project where teams define, design and deliver an engineered product or system
  • General education and professional skills: technical communication, ethics, project management and elective technical depth or breadth

Career prospects

Graduates with a bachelor’s in electrical/electronic engineering go into a wide range of technical roles across industry. Common entry‑level positions include electronics engineer, embedded systems engineer, test and validation engineer, controls engineer, field service engineer, and applications or design engineer.

Employment sectors include consumer electronics, automotive and mobility systems, industrial automation, power and energy, telecommunications, medical devices, manufacturing and defence. Many graduates also pursue graduate study in electrical engineering or related disciplines, or move into engineering management, technical sales, or product development roles.
